MenuI've played a large role in 3 exits and found that transparency has always been the best policy. I would make sure you spend individual time with each exec to make sure they are completely comfortable.
In one of my exits we let the whole company of 40 people know very early on that we were taking the company to market. We set up a incentive plan to ensure everyone was aligned and working towards growing value.
At smaller companies the team will pick up on acquisitions very quickly: asking your team to answer prepare certain reports, answering due diligence questions, strange visitors, etc. It is better for you to control the narrative then let the rumor mill spin out of control.
